Our Swiss laboratory is moving to a new home

We are delighted to announce the start of a phased move of our Swiss laboratory to a new location, at Landstrasse 23 in Kaiseraugst, which will culminate in the  unveiling of the new facility on Friday 11th May.

Our laboratory services will continue to be available throughout this move, which is already in progress, and we will endeavour to ensure that analysis results will be sent as close as possible to our usual turn times.  Samples can continue to be sent to the usual address at Rinaustrasse 452, which is just 5 minutes from the new laboratory.

However, please note that our AOG / SEM sample analysis services will be unavailable on the following dates:

  • For chip, debris and filter samples requiring analysis by Scanning Electron Microscope (SEM) the service will be unavailable at the Swiss facility from Monday 30th April through to Friday 4th May inclusive.  This is due to the sensitive nature of these machines which require specialist handling and calibration.
     
  • Customers' AOG / SEM samples will be redirected to our UK laboratory for completion within 48 hours
